Bay scallop season to close Sept. 25 in several areas

Recreational bay scallop season harvest will close Sept. 25 in Gulf County through northwest Taylor County, and in Levy through Hernando counties. The last day harvest will be open is Sept. 24. Once these areas close, scallop harvest will not reopen until the 2021 season.
